Jane Lynch Settles Her Divorce
Posted by Andru Edwards Categories: Television, Divorce, Legal Issues,
Jane Lynch has amicably settled her divorce.
The Glee star, who filed court documents in July to legally dissolve her three-year marriage to clinical psychologist Lara Embry, whom she split from in February 2012, is still on "very civilized" terms with her ex-wife after coming to an agreement.
A source told gossip website TMZ.com that Lara agreed to accept a more modest sum of spousal support after initially seeking $93,000 per month, and Jane secured full ownership of their former marital home in Los Angeles, which she paid for in full. The former couple, who cited "irreconcilable differences" in their divorce papers, are now on good terms and spent time together over the festive period.
Jane, 53, previously insisted that her divorce was "not a horrible thing" and friends explained the actress wanted to stay friends with Lara for the sake of her former spouse's 10-year-old daughter, Haden. "It's not dramatic. It's not a horrible thing. It's something that we're dealing with. It's two people who just decided it's better to go apart than stay together," she said.

Jane Lynch’s Ex-Wife Seeks Spousal Support
Posted by Andru Edwards Categories: Movies, Television, Divorce, Legal Issues,
Jane Lynch's estranged wife Lara Embry is seeking spousal support.
The Glee star announced in July she was legally ending her three-year-marriage to the clinical psychologist, whom she split from in February. Lara has now filed documents in Los Angeles Superior Court asking for her attorney fees to be paid by Jane, along with spousal support despite the 53-year-old actress previously seeking to terminate the court's jurisdiction to award spousal support to her ex-wife, according to People.com.
Jane recently insisted their divorce was "not a horrible" thing: "It's not dramatic. "It's not a horrible thing. It's something that we're dealing with. It's two people who just decided it's better to go apart than stay together."
The former couple are determined to maintain an amicable relationship for Lara's daughter, Haden. "All's good. We have a little girl - she has a little girl who's very dear to me. She's 10, and she's doing great ... We have to remain adults, which we have. We keep everybody's - especially Haden's - good in our mind," Jane added.
Jane Lynch Files for Divorce
Posted by Andru Edwards Categories: Television, Divorce, Legal Issues,
Jane Lynch has officially filed for divorce from her wife Dr. Lara Embry.
The Glee star and her spouse of three years announced they were splitting last month, and she filed papers to legally end their marriage in Los Angeles County Court on Friday. The 52-year-old actress cited "irreconcilable differences" as the reason for the couple's split and stated that they have been separated since February, according to gossip website TMZ.com.
After announcing their split in June, Jane released a statement insisting she and Lara still "care very deeply" about one another. "Lara and I have decided to end our marriage. This has been a difficult decision for us as we care very deeply about one another. We ask for privacy as we deal with this family matter," she added.
They first met in 2009 at a fundraiser in San Francisco, California, at which Lara, 44, was receiving an honor. The pair got engaged in 2010 and got married on Memorial Day the same year in an intimate ceremony in Sunderland, Massachusetts.
Jane Lynch to Divorce Wife
Posted by Andru Edwards Categories: Television, Divorce,
Jane Lynch and her wife are divorcing.
The Glee star and her spouse Dr. Lara Embry have announced they are splitting after three years of marriage but insists they still "care very deeply" about one another. In a statement released to People, Jane said, "Lara and I have decided to end our marriage. This has been a difficult decision for us as we care very deeply about one another. We ask for privacy as we deal with this family matter."
Jane, 52, and Lara, 44, first in 2009 at a fundraiser in San Francisco at which Embry was receiving an honor. The pair got engaged in 2010 and got married on Memorial Day the same year in an intimate ceremony in Sunderland, Massachusetts - which is one of only a handful of US states where gay marriage is recognized.
Lara has got a daughter called Haden with whom Jane got very close to during the relationship, previously describing her as her "greatest pleasure" in life. Jane - who plays tough cheerleader coach Sue Sylvester in the musical drama - previously said, "My greatest pleasure is Haden, my stepdaughter. I am surprised how much love you feel and how you would do anything for your children. Some may say I know a thing or two about playing intimidating authority figures but she knows how important love and acceptance is. I am in love and in awe with Haden. I like watching her walk through the world without fear. She happens to be an exceptional human being and one of the most fair, open-hearted, embracing people I have ever met - grown-up or child."
